Mazda declared most fuel efficient car for 4 consecutiv­e years

-

For the fourth straight year, the U.S. Environmen­tal Protection Agency (EPA) has given Mazda the highest fuel-efficiency rating in its latest Light Duty Fuel Economy Trends report. Running at 30.7 miles per gallon (approximat­ely 13 kilometers per liter), Mazda outranked eleven other car manufactur­ers, even those that produce hybrid and electric vehicles. This finding further validates the real world advantage of Mazda’s SKYACTIV Technology. SKYACTIV is a suite of component and engineerin­g technologi­es intended to cut vehicle weight, improve engine efficiency and bolster vehicle dynamics for outstandin­g environmen­tal and safety performanc­e without sacrificin­g the brand’s renowned driving pleasure.

Mazda has re-engineered every auto component— from the engine, transmissi­on, body and chassis— to work in perfect harmony and significan­tly reduce fuel consumptio­n without compromisi­ng driving performanc­e.
